Swansea could make another move for Real Betis midfielder Benat, while Arsenal have also entered the race to sign him.
The 25-year-old has a contract until 2014 but Betis are keen to get him tied down to a new one in an attempt to fight off interested clubs but so far he has refused to sign.
Betis now face an awkward situation as they cannot run the risk of losing him for nothing so they could be forced to cash in when the transfer window re-opens.
Arsenal are keeping tabs on the situation, as are Swansea, after Michael Laudrup failed with a bid to sign him in the summer and could make a fresh approach in January.
Betis are keen to keep hold of the Spain international but realise they could struggle to fight off interested clubs because of the player's contract situation.
"We can't rule out the possibility that Benat could leave in the winter," Betis director Jose Antonio Bosch revealed. "Negotiations on a contract renewal are fluid, but so far no progress has been made because the positions are so different.
"We realise that Benat may earn more at other clubs than at Betis."
